Meaning of Stolen Dance by Milky Chance

The song “Stolen Dance” by Milky Chance is about yearning for a lost connection and the desire to rekindle moments of joy and togetherness.

The song feels both happy and a bit sad, like dancing in the rain. It’s about missing someone but still finding joy in memories.

In the chorus, we hear about dancing like never before, capturing a sense of freedom and pure joy—those times when we let loose and forget everything else. The verses take us on a journey through longing and nostalgia, with lines like “Your heart is too strong anyway,” suggesting that despite separation, love remains powerful. We feel the pain of absence, but the boogie carries us away to paradise, even if we “shouldn’t talk about it,” perhaps because talking might break the spell.

Ultimately, “Stolen Dance” is an ode to the power of music and dance to bridge emotional gaps. It reminds us that even when we’re apart from those we care about, shared experiences keep us connected.
